Pressure tank maintenance is essential for protecting your well pump and ensuring consistent household water pressure. A failing or improperly balanced pressure tank can cause short cycling, high energy consumption, and unnecessary strain on pump components. Proper pressure tank service improves system efficiency, stabilizes water delivery, and protects your well pump from costly damage.

Step 1: Schedule and System Review
We review your well system history, current performance, and maintenance coverage, then schedule service at a convenient time.
Step 2: Full System Inspection
Our technicians perform a comprehensive inspection of the well pump, motor, electrical components, and pressure system following our inspection policy.
Step 3: Pump and Flow Testing
We test water flow, motor amperage, and pump performance to detect wear, short cycling, or efficiency issues.
Step 4: Pressure Tank Evaluation
We check air charge levels, pressure switch function, and overall system balance to ensure stable water pressure.
Step 5: Preventative Adjustments
Minor electrical issues, pressure concerns, and system imbalances are corrected to prevent future breakdowns.
Step 6: Final Testing and Documentation
We retest the system for proper operation and document all findings to maintain long-term well system reliability.

Routine well pump maintenance helps maintain consistent water pressure, prevent motor burnout, reduce short cycling, and identify early warning signs of pump failure. Regular servicing significantly lowers the risk of costly emergency pump repairs and extends the overall life of your well system.
Common signs include fluctuating water pressure, rapid pump cycling, higher electric bills, air sputtering from faucets, or inconsistent water flow. A professional pressure tank inspection can verify proper air charge levels, inspect the pressure switch, and ensure the system is operating efficiently.
